Definition & Meaning of "soporific"

Soporific
01

a drug that induces sleep

soporific
01

causing one to become sleepy and mentally inactive

example
Example
click on words
The dim lighting and soft voices created a soporific atmosphere in the room.
The lecture was so soporific that several students struggled to stay awake.
The long, monotonous drive had a soporific quality, leading him to doze off at the wheel.
